Legalities
 
The legal status of the pay for sex in Leatherhead Common market differs significantly across the globe, with some nations adopting a more permissive method, while others enforce rigid charges or perhaps criminalize the act entirely.
 
Decriminalization: In some jurisdictions, such as New Zealand, the act of exchanging sex for cash is ruled out prohibited, and sex work is dealt with as a genuine profession. This method has actually been praised for focusing on the safety and rights of sex workers.
 
Legalization: Countries such as Germany and the Netherlands have actually legalized prostitution and carried out policies to govern the market, such as compulsory registration, medical examination, and tax. Supporters argue that this technique helps in reducing exploitation and human trafficking.
 
Criminalization: In other parts of the world, such as the United States (with the exception of some counties in Nevada) and much of Africa, Asia, and the Middle East, both the buying and selling of sex are strictly prohibited and punishable by law.
